Barbecued Meatballs
Ready In: 45 mins
Serves: 4-5
Yields: 1 1/2 dozen
Ingredients
Meatballs
- 1 egg, beaten
- 1 cup crisp rice cereal, crushed and divided
- 1 tablespoon finely chopped onion
- 1⁄2 teaspoon salt
- 1⁄4 teaspoon pepper
- 1 lb ground beef
Sauce
- 1⁄4 cup packed brown sugar
- 3 tablespoons ketchup
- 1 teaspoon prepared mustard
- 1⁄8 teaspoon ground nutmeg
Directions
- In a large bowl, combine the egg, 3/4 cup cereal, onion, salt and pepper. Crumble beef over mixture and mix well. For sauce, in a small bowl, combine the remaining ingredients. Add 2 tablespoons sauce to meat mixture; mix well. Shape into 1 1/2-inch balls.
- Place meatballs on a greased rack in a shallow baking pan. Brush with remaining sauce; sprinkle with remaining cereal. Bake uncovered, at 400 for 20-25 minutes or until no longer pink; drain.
